Protecting Against Ad-Hoc Query Exploits

Ad-hoc queries are temporary SQL queries created and executed to perform a specific task without prior preparation or to save as permanent procedures or functions. Usually, they can be used to analyze data, search for particular information, or solve temporary tasks. However, if user-defined input data generates the text in ad-hoc queries dynamically, they may be vulnerable to SQL injections. How to Install and Connect ODBC Drivers in UNIX

Imagine you’re working in a UNIX-based environment, managing multiple databases like MariaDB, PostgreSQL, or Oracle, and you have to connect their data to different applications. Without UNIX ODBC drivers, you’d have to write custom code for each database, which would quickly turn into a nightmare — each database has its own way of handling queries, connections, and authentication. Luckily, ODBC drivers can save the day by acting as “translators”.
